As some of you know, I am going out of town for a week. Very Happy
This is just to let you all in on my preparations as far as making sure that my animals do not suffer in my absence. Cool

The snakes have been fed, Wednesday; their cages were cleaned Friday. I will do a final water check tonight to make sure that they have plenty of water and if they knock it over, it's still all good. Laughing

The rat and gerbil racks have also been cleaned and the rats have an automatic watering system, so all I have to do is shovel food on the troughs and they are good to go.



This is the rat with the apparent inner ear infection..she's just given birth to a nice litter, so I don't want to bother her.



The rabbits were a challenge, but I have managed to make sure that they were amply taken care of...peep this!

The basic hutch fell apart!! I had to be creative and "glue" it back together so that they could no longer get out.





Building an extension to the hutch so that they can exercise (will also reduce the tendency to chew the hutch up Laughing ).



The final product:





Rigged up a water hose so that they would have constant running water.



Made sure that if the bottom fell out while I was gone (I did ensure that it wouldn't!! but..just in case) wrapped wire around the legs and covered up the empty spaces with more wire.



And that's how I take care of MY animals. Laughing
